Understanding the Legal Landscape of Real Estate Repossession in Nakuru
The repossession of real estate in Nakuru is a highly regulated process, primarily governed by the Land Act, 2012, which details the rights and procedures for mortgagees. This legislation outlines the conditions under which a lender can take possession of a property following a borrower's default on loan obligations. Crucially, it mandates specific notice periods and methods of communication, ensuring the defaulting party has a fair opportunity to rectify the situation. Compliance with the Civil Procedure Act is also essential, particularly if court intervention becomes necessary to enforce possession. Understanding nuances like the type of charge instrument (e.g., a charge to secure loan or an equitable charge) and its implications on the repossession process is vital. The Systematic Process of Real Estate Repossession in Nakuru
Initiating real estate repossession Nakuru with Swipe Recoveries Experts Ltd involves a systematic, step-by-step approach designed for maximum efficiency and legal integrity. The process commences with a thorough verification of the property's legal status and the borrower's default, cross-referenced with records at the Nakuru Lands Registry. Subsequently, formal notices are dispatched to the defaulting party, adhering strictly to the timelines specified in the charge instrument and relevant statutes, such as the 30-day notice under the Land Act. This phase is critical for establishing a legally sound basis for further action. If the default is not cured, our team proceeds with securing and taking physical possession of the property, always conducted in a peaceful and orderly manner, as dictated by the Penal Code regarding trespass and breach of peace. Our firm liaises closely with legal counsel to manage any potential legal challenges, including appearances in the Nakuru Magistrate’s Court or higher courts if required.
